**THE NOVEL**

Published in December 1996, Alias Grace is Margaret Atwood’s historical fiction masterpiece set in 1840s Canada. Based on the true story of Grace Marks, a young Irish immigrant servant convicted of murdering her employer and his housekeeper, the novel weaves together courtroom drama, psychological mystery, and Victorian-era social commentary. It won the inaugural Giller Prize, was shortlisted for the Booker Prize and Governor General’s Award, and earned Atwood Italy’s Premio Mondello.

**THE STORY**

Told through alternating first-person narrative and documentary fragments — letters, diary entries, trial transcripts — the novel follows Dr. Simon Jordan, a physician who visits Grace in prison to determine if she’s fit for a pardon. As Grace recounts her life story, the line between truth and invention blurs. The Netflix miniseries adaptation (2017), directed by Mary Harron and written by Sarah Polley, brought renewed attention to the book, starring Sarah Gadon as Grace Marks alongside Edward Holcroft, Zachary Levi, and David Cronenberg.
